Cherie MacLeod, City of Seattle, Marijuana Program Coordinator, Regulatory Compliance & Consumer Protection Division, sent this to me
As for license renewals, the marijuana business licenses expire June 30 each year. Businesses must renew prior to July 1 to be in compliance. The code section below for issuance of licenses also applies to renewals, and details the reasons for denial of the license.

• 6.500.090 - Issuance of licenses
The Director shall deny a license and shall notify the applicant in writing of the reasons for denial and the opportunity to appeal, if the Director finds any of the following:
No license shall be issued to:
• The property at which the business is located has been determined by a court to be a chronic nuisance property as provided in SMC Chapter 10.09.
• The license may be otherwise denied under Section 6.202.230
Section 6.202.230
M. The property at which the business is located has been determined by a court to be a chronic nuisance property as provided in SMC Chapter 10.09.
